Detailed Features Analysis of AWS
Amazon Web Services (AWS) is a leading cloud computing platform, offering a vast array of services. Here’s a breakdown of some key features:
- Elastic Compute Cloud (EC2): EC2 provides virtual servers in the cloud, allowing users to run applications of any size. It offers various instance types optimized for different workloads, from general-purpose computing to memory-intensive applications. The user benefit is scalability and flexibility, allowing you to scale your computing resources up or down based on demand. This demonstrates quality by providing a robust and reliable infrastructure for running applications.
- Simple Storage Service (S3): S3 is a highly scalable object storage service that allows users to store and retrieve any amount of data. It’s ideal for storing backups, archives, and media files. The user benefit is secure and durable storage with low latency access. This demonstrates expertise in data management and storage solutions.
- Relational Database Service (RDS): RDS makes it easy to set up, operate, and scale relational databases in the cloud. It supports various database engines, including MySQL, PostgreSQL, and SQL Server. The user benefit is simplified database management and improved performance. This demonstrates quality by providing a managed database service that reduces operational overhead.
- Lambda: Lambda is a serverless compute service that allows users to run code without provisioning or managing servers. It automatically scales resources based on demand. The user benefit is reduced operational costs and increased agility. This demonstrates expertise in modern application development and deployment.
- Identity and Access Management (IAM): IAM enables users to manage access to AWS resources. It allows you to create and manage AWS users and groups, and use permissions to allow and deny their access to AWS resources. The user benefit is enhanced security and compliance. This demonstrates quality by providing granular control over access to sensitive data and resources.
- Virtual Private Cloud (VPC): VPC enables users to launch AWS resources into a logically isolated virtual network. You have complete control over your virtual networking environment, including the selection of your own IP address range, creation of subnets, and configuration of route tables and network gateways. The user benefit is enhanced security and control over network traffic. This demonstrates expertise in network security and isolation.
- CloudWatch: CloudWatch provides monitoring and management services for AWS resources and applications. It allows you to collect and track metrics, collect and monitor log files, set alarms, and automatically react to changes in your AWS environment. The user benefit is improved visibility and control over your AWS infrastructure. This demonstrates quality by providing comprehensive monitoring and alerting capabilities.

Question: What are the key differences between a Bachelor of Science in Computer Science (BSCS) and a Bachelor of Arts in Computer Science (BACS)?
Answer: A BSCS typically focuses more heavily on technical and scientific aspects of computing, with a greater emphasis on mathematics and theoretical foundations. A BACS often provides a broader liberal arts education, with more flexibility to take courses outside of computer science. The choice depends on your interests and career goals; a BSCS is generally preferred for technical roles, while a BACS may be suitable for roles that require strong communication and problem-solving skills.

Question: What programming languages are most in-demand by employers in 2024?
Answer: Python, Java, JavaScript, and C++ remain highly in-demand. Additionally, languages like Go and Rust are gaining popularity due to their performance and security features. Staying current with industry trends is crucial for IT professionals.

Question: What are the essential skills for a cybersecurity professional?
Answer: Key skills include network security, cryptography, ethical hacking, incident response, and knowledge of security frameworks and regulations. A strong understanding of operating systems and programming languages is also essential.
